If you’re in your late 30s or 40s and suddenly you donʻt feel like yourself, you may have entered perimenopause or menopause. While both are natural transitions, they are not the same thing. Let’s break down what happens, when it happens, and—most importantly—how to manage the symptoms.



What They Mean & Age of Onset


Perimenopause means “around menopause.” It is the months or years leading up to your final menstrual period, as your ovaries begin to slow down. Perimenopause typically starts between ages 40 and 44, though some women notice changes as early as their mid-30s.


Menopause is a single point in time: the 12 consecutive months without a period. The average age is 51 (normal range: 45–55). After this, you are postmenopausal.


What Happens in the Body: The Hormone Rollercoaster


Before perimenopause, estrogen and progesterone rise and fall in a predictable monthly rhythm. During perimenopause, that rhythm becomes chaotic:


· Estrogen spikes and drops erratically.

· Progesterone falls more consistently, creating a relative estrogen dominance.

· FSH rises as your brain tries harder to stimulate ovulation.


By late perimenopause and menopause, both estrogen and progesterone remain chronically low.


The Domino Effect: Mood, Appetite, and Metabolic Health


Mood Changes


The erratic swings in estrogen also affect the levels of serotonin (the feel good hormone) leading to anxiety, irritability, brain fog, and depression. Sleep disruption from night sweats worsens everything.


Appetite


During your reproductive years, estrogen helps regulate hunger and fullness hormones. When estrogen levels decline and fluctuate during midlife, this regulation is disrupted. The hunger hormone, ghrelin, can become more pronounced or feel stronger during this time. Meanwhile, signalling to the brain from leptin (the fullness hormone) may become less effective, making it harder for you to sense the feeling of fullness. Many women experience stronger cravings for sugar and refined carbohydrates and feel hungry soon after meals.


Hot flushes and night sweats


Hot flushes are the most widely reported symptom during perimenopause and are caused by declining estrogen levels. Your may suddenly start feeling hot and sweaty and this may last for several minutes. It may be accompanied by palpitations or anxiety.


Sleep Disruption

During menopause, hormonal changes can cause sleep disturbances. Hot flushes are one of the most frequently reported reasons for waking up at night. Additionally, women in perimenopause have a higher risk of developing conditions like sleep apnea and restless leg syndrome, which can further disrupt sleep.


General Metabolic Health (Deep Dive)


This is the biggest sleeper issue. Lower estrogen changes three core metabolic systems:


1. Weight gain (and why it’s not your fault)

During perimenopause, the average woman gains 1.5–2 pounds per year. Women tend to gain fat mass and lose lean mass during this transition period. Additionally, the decline in estrogen levels prompts redistribution of fat to the abdomen. Visceral fat (the deep belly fat around your organs) fat releases inflammatory chemicals that can contribute to other metabolic conditions.


2. Insulin sensitivity & blood sugar

Estrogen helps your cells respond to insulin. As estrogen falls, cells become more insulin resistant. Blood glucose stays higher longer after meals which can eventually cause prediabetes or type 2 diabetes. Even normal-weight women can develop insulin resistance during menopause.


3. Cardiovascular health


The shifts in fat distribution and insulin resistance that take place during perimenopause are also associated with increased cardiovascular risk factors such as elevated blood pressure, elevated low-density lipoprotein (LDL), and obesity. Additionally, estrogen which protects the health of your blood vessels is on the decline, further contributing to an increased cardivascular risk.


How to Manage Symptoms (Beyond “Just Deal With It”)


  1. Seek advice about Hormone Therapy (HT) from your doctor, it can help alleviate some of the symptoms

  2. Stress management – High cortisol worsens hormonal chaos. Try 10 minutes of deep breathing, morning sunlight, or yoga.

  3. Sleep hygiene – sleep in a dark and cool bedroom to 65–68°F (18–20°C)

  4. Strength training – 2–3 times weekly to preserve muscle and bone density.

What to Eat to Improve Metabolic Health (Plant-Based First)


You cannot “eat your way out of menopause,” but you can dramatically reduce visceral fat, stabilize blood sugar, and protect your heart. Aim to reduce intake of refined carbohydrates and sugar and focus on increasing whole grains, fruits and vegetables.


These strategies start with plant foods; where animal protein is an option, it’s noted in italics.


1. Prioritize Protein at Every Meal (25–40g)


Plant base: Tofu, tempeh, edamame, seitan, beans, lentils, chickpeas, black beans, pumpkin seeds, hemp hearts, pea or soy protein powder.


Optional add (meat/fish): Eggs, Greek yogurt, cottage cheese, chicken, turkey, salmon, sardines, or whey protein.


Why: Protein increases satiety, keeping you fuller for longer and preventing the blood sugar spikes from carbs. Itʻs also important for preserving muscle.


2. Eat Carbs in a “Sequence” to Flatten Blood Sugar


Eat vegetables first → then protein/fat → then starches/sugars. Always pair carbs with protein, fat, or fiber. Example: Apple with almond butter → lower glucose rise than apple alone.


Best plant carb sources: Non-starchy vegetables (broccoli, spinach, zucchini), berries, cherries, whole fruits (not juice), steel-cut oats, quinoa, barley, beans, and lentils.


Optional add: Same meal works with added grilled chicken or salmon on the side.


3. Target Visceral Fat with Fiber & Resistant Starch


Visceral fat responds well to soluble fiber and resistant starch. Aim for 25–35g total fiber daily.


Plant sources:


· Soluble fiber: Oats, flaxseeds (ground), chia seeds, Brussels sprouts, beans, lentils, apples, citrus.

· Resistant starch: Cooked and cooled potatoes or pasta, green bananas, plantains, barley, beans.


Optional add: Resistant starch is plant-only by definition, so no animal addition needed. But a meal of beans + greens works with or without a small piece of fish.


4. Switch to Heart-Protective Fats


Replace butter and coconut oil with unsaturated fats. Limit saturated fat to <10% of calories.


Plant sources: Olive oil, avocados, nuts (walnuts, almonds), seeds (flax, chia, hemp), and tahini. For omega-3s (lower triglycerides, reduce inflammation): ground flaxseeds, chia seeds, hemp seeds, walnuts, and algae-based omega-3 supplements.


Optional add (fish): Fatty fish 2x/week (salmon, mackerel, sardines, anchovies) provides DHA/EPA omega-3s directly. If adding fish, you can reduce algae supplement.


5. Balance Sodium & Potassium for Blood Pressure


As cardiovascular protection declines, blood pressure becomes salt-sensitive.


Plant sources for potassium (helps balance sodium): Sweet potatoes, spinach, Swiss chard, white beans, kidney beans, bananas, avocados, tomatoes, coconut water, and potatoes with skin.


Reduce sodium: Cook with herbs, spices, citrus, and vinegar instead of salt. Avoid processed plant meats that can be high in sodium (check labels).


Optional add: Same potassium-rich vegetables pair well with any animal protein; just don’t salt the meat heavily.


Bonus: Time Your Meals


Many women find that stopping eating by 7pm reduces night sweats and improves fasting glucose. A 12-hour overnight fast (e.g., 7pm to 7am) gives insulin levels time to fall between days.


A Sample Plant-First Day (with optional additions)


Breakfast: Tofu scramble with spinach, mushrooms, and half an avocado + 1 slice sourdough.

  Optional add: 2 eggs instead of tofu, or a side of smoked salmon.


Lunch: Large salad with 1 cup chickpeas, quinoa, cucumber, tomatoes, hemp hearts, and olive oil vinaigrette.

  Optional add: 4oz grilled chicken or sardines.


Snack: Coconut yogurt (plain) with ground flaxseeds, walnuts, and a few dark chocolate chips.

  Optional add: 1 hard-boiled egg or small Greek yogurt.


Dinner: Baked tempeh or tofu, roasted broccoli and sweet potato, with tahini drizzle.

  Optional add: Baked salmon instead of tempeh.


Evening: Chamomile tea or magnesium glycinate (check with your doctor).
